An advanced ABCD fragment (see picture) constructed on the way to the total synthesis of the potent antitumor agent (+)-spongistatin 2 has also been used in a formal total synthesis of (+)-spongistatin 1. In both cases the critical step was an acid-mediated epimerization in the presence of Ca2+ ions to stabilize the axial–equitorial CD spiroketal.
